It's just an expression of how listless one feels when their last hyperfixation lost its sparkles and a new one hasn't cropped up yet. It's not that challenging to grasp, for those who've experienced it. It's not a choice, either. One day you feel intensely driven to read/watch/create/engage with everything about one particular topic or through one particular hobby, but then the next day -poof- the feeling is gone. And in that moment you feel empty, unsure what to do next.

It's not boredom. It's not laziness. It's a temporary sense of directionlessness that you have no control over.
